Challenging Political Polling and Public Opinion

This chapter delves into the intricacies of political polling and the challenges of accurately measuring public opinion. It critiques the simplistic view of democracy as a sum of individual opinions, emphasizing the need for reasoning and the impact of misinformation on representing the public will.
